Put simply, a drill-through is just a separate tab on your Power BI dashboard. If you want to "evolve" a tab into a drill through tab, you just need to assign a field to it.

Step by Step Guide
1. I will create a simple page (tab) to show video game details for a single title.

Without anything selected, you'll notice the following:

2. In that "drill-through" field, I will drag the column/field "Game" into it.

3. That's really all there is to it! On the main dashboard page, if you have a visual with the "Game" column on it, you can right-click and select drill-through.
